About a month ago I had a week of freaky lightheadedness and dizziness, mostly when sitting but not at all when walking. I was worried that it was a symptom of my brain mets. (especially since I have chosen to sit still on rads and see what the Tykerb/Xeloda does to them). I saw my onc during that week and described it to him. He asked all the appropriate questions and did the appropriate exams, but wanted me mostly to keep an eye on my walking... if I started stumbling or walking like I was drunk, then we would have cause for concern. We also speculated about the fact that the mold counts in Texas are off the chart this summer because of our non-stop rain, and perhaps it was an allergy symptom. That was what he felt was more likely. I went home and the next day I started a regimine of Allegra, Nasalcrom and 3 Motrin every morning. By day two, my left ear started popping like when you are driving down a mountain or it is drying out from having water in the ear. It popped sporatically for the next day and a half. And, by day two, my dizziness went away. I told the onc what I had been doing and he said that the dizziness had apparently been from fluid collecting due to allergies/mold, and then the popping was because of intermittent opening of the Eustachian tube that was swollen and causing the fluid to collect in the middle ear.

What a relief that was! So I just keep taking my Allegra every day and haven't had any dizziness since. We have my next brain MRI scheduled for Aug 13.
